Многие пользователи Adobe After Effects сталкиваются с проблемой, когда программа не задействует мощную видеокарту, ограничиваясь процессором. Это приводит к низким частотам кадров в предпросмотре и долгому времени рендеринга сложных композиций. Ускорение GPU является критически важным для работы с эффектами, 3D-графикой и цветокоррекцией.
Правильная настройка среды позволяет снизить нагрузку на центральный процессор и перераспределить задачи на видеоядро. В современных версиях софта инженеры Adobe реализовали технологию Mercury Playback Engine, которая поддерживает аппаратное ускорение. Однако, по умолчанию, система может работать в режиме программной обработки, игнорируя возможности NVIDIA или AMD.
Чтобы устранить этот дисбаланс, необходимо не только проверить глобальные настройки программы, но и убедиться в корректности работы драйверов и совместимости железа. Игнорирование этих шагов часто приводит к тому, что даже топовая видеокарта работает вхолостую, а рендеринг занимает часы вместо минут.
Включение ускорения GPU в настройках проекта
Первым шагом для активации видеоядра является изменение глобальных параметров рендеринга внутри интерфейса программы. Вам нужно перейти в раздел Файл → Проектные настройки (File → Project Settings). Здесь находится ключевой параметр, отвечающий за выбор движка рендеринга.
В выпадающем списке «Видео-адаптер» (Video Rendering and Effects) необходимо сменить значение «Только программная обработка» на «Mercury Playback Engine GPU ускорение». Если этот пункт недоступен или программа выдает ошибку, значит, драйверы не распознаны или видеокарта не поддерживается официально.
Существует три основных режима работы:Только программная обработка (CPU), Mercury Playback Engine GPU ускорение (CUDA) для карт NVIDIA и OpenCL для карт AMD или Intel. Выбор правильного режима напрямую влияет на скорость преобразования эффектов.
Почему иногда режим GPU не активируется?
Часто проблема кроется в устаревших драйверах. Если видеокарта слишком старая, она может не поддерживать текущую версию After Effects. Проверьте список совместимости на сайте Adobe.
После смены режима на GPU-ускорение, вы должны увидеть, что в статусной строке внизу интерфейса отображается информация о загруженности видеокарты. Если этого не происходит, попробуйте перезапустить приложение и убедиться, что система видит адаптер.
Проверка совместимости драйверов и адаптеров
Даже если вы включили правильные настройки, приложение может не работать с видеокартой из-за неверной версии драйвера. Для профессионального софта, такого как Adobe After Effects, критически важно использовать драйверы типа Studio (для NVIDIA) или Pro (для AMD), а не игровые версии.
Игровые драйверы оптимизированы под fps в играх и часто содержат нестабильные функции для профессиональных задач, что приводит к вылетам или отсутствию ускорения. Установите GeForce Experience или зайдите на сайт производителя и скачайте именно версию для студийных приложений.
Важно проверить, поддерживает ли ваша конкретная модель драйвер CUDA или OpenCL. В списке совместимости Adobe часто указаны только определенные серии видеокарт, например, начиная с архитектуры Pascal или выше. Старые карты могут работать только в режиме процессора.
⚠️ Внимание: Никогда не используйте бета-версии драйверов для работы с рендерингом. Это может привести к артефактам на изображении или полной остановке процесса рендера в середине задачи.
Иногда система может не видеть видеокарту из-за конфликта с встроенным графическим ядром процессора. В диспетчере устройств убедитесь, что дискретная карта активна и на ней нет желтых восклицательных знаков.
Настройка памяти и производительности системы
После активации GPU необходимо убедиться, что у системы достаточно ресурсов для обработки данных. After Effects — это «прожорливое» приложение, которое требует много оперативной памяти (RAM) для кэширования кадров.
Перейдите в Редактирование → Настройки → Память и производительность (Edit → Preferences → Memory & Performance). Здесь вы увидите ползунок, распределяющий память между Adobe и другими приложениями. Для стабильной работы с GPU-ускорением выделите минимум 8-12 ГБ для других программ, чтобы система не зависала при фоновых задачах.
В разделе «Производительность» (Performance) можно выбрать количество ядер процессора, которые будут использоваться. Однако, если GPU активирован верно, нагрузка на ядра CPU при предпросмотре снизится. Это позволяет использовать оставшиеся ресурсы для других процессов.
Не забудьте настроить кэш диска. Укажите быстрый SSD-диск для хранения кэша, иначе скорость рендеринга упадет, даже при мощной видеокарте. Медленный жесткий диск станет «бутылочным горлышком» для всей системы.
Таблица совместимости видеокарт и технологий
Не все видеокарты поддерживают одинаковый набор функций ускорения. Понимание разницы между технологиями поможет вам выбрать правильное оборудование или правильно настроить текущее. Ниже приведена таблица основных технологий и их назначения.
| Технология | Производитель видеокарт | Назначение в After Effects |
|---|---|---|
| CUDA | NVIDIA | Основной стандарт для рендеринга и эффектов |
| OpenCL | AMD / Intel | Альтернатива CUDA для карт без поддержки NVIDIA |
| Metal | Apple (Mac) | Ускорение только в macOS версиях |
| DirectX | Windows | Базовая поддержка интерфейса и предварительного просмотра |
Если вы используете карту AMD, убедитесь, что в настройках проекта выбран именно режим OpenCL, а не CUDA, так как карты NVIDIA не поддерживают OpenCL полноценно для рендеринга, и наоборот.
Решение проблем с отсутствием ускорения
Если после всех манипуляций видеокарта по-прежнему не используется, попробуйте выполнить сброс настроек. Зажмите клавиши Ctrl + Shift (Windows) или Cmd + Shift (Mac) сразу при запуске программы, пока не появится диалоговое окно сброса настроек.
Иногда проблема кроется в конфликте версий. Если вы обновили After Effects до новой версии, но не обновили драйверы, система может деактивировать GPU-ускорение в целях безопасности. Всегда обновляйте драйверы до актуальной версии Studio перед обновлением софта.
Также стоит проверить, не отключена ли видеокарта в BIOS материнской платы. В редких случаях при переключении монитора на встроенную графику, дискретная карта может переходить в спящий режим и игнорироваться приложением.
☑️ Чек-лист проверки GPU
Оптимизация для конкретных эффектов
Не все эффекты в After Effects поддерживают аппаратное ускорение. Некоторые плагины и встроенные фильтры работают исключительно на процессоре (CPU). Это не означает, что видеокарта бесполезна, но она не будет задействована для этих конкретных задач.
Например, эффекты из пакета Red Giant или Trapcode часто имеют свои настройки оптимизации. В свойствах самого эффекта (Effect Controls) может быть галочка Использовать GPU (Use GPU). Убедитесь, что она включена для каждого тяжелого эффекта.
Если вы работаете с 3D-слоями, видеокарта используется для расчета геометрии и освещения. В этом случае важно использовать трехмерный движок CINEON или Classic 3D, так как они лучше всего оптимизированы под GPU. Новый движок 3D в последних версиях требует более мощного железа.
Помните, что ускорение GPU наиболее эффективно при предпросмотре. При финальном рендеринге в Render Queue некоторые этапы могут снова переложить нагрузку на CPU, если рендер-конвейер (Output Module) не настроен на использование видеокарты.
Заключение и итоговые рекомендации
Сделать так, чтобы After Effects использовал видеокарту, — это комплексная задача, требующая настройки как самого приложения, так и операционной системы. Ключевым фактором успеха является правильный выбор режима рендеринга Mercury Playback Engine и использование сертифицированных драйверов.
Игнорирование обновлений драйверов или использование неподходящих версий ПО часто сводит на нет усилия по оптимизации. Регулярно проверяйте совместимость вашей видеокарты с новыми версиями Adobe, чтобы избежать проблем с производительностью.
Помните, что даже при полной загрузке GPU, процессор остается важным элементом системы, так как он управляет логикой композиции. Баланс между CPU и GPU — залог стабильной и быстрой работы в любом проекте.
⚠️ Внимание: Если вы используете модуль рендеринга через сеть, убедитесь, что сетевые настройки не ограничивают передачу данных к видеокарте. Медленная сеть может имитировать отсутствие ускорения GPU.
В случае возникновения специфических ошибок, всегда проверяйте логи ошибок в папке Logs внутри директории установки. Там могут быть указаны точные причины, почему видеокарта не была инициализирована корректно.
Почему в настройках проекта нет пункта GPU ускорение?
Это означает, что после Effects не видит совместимую видеокарту или драйверы не установлены корректно. Проверьте наличие драйверов Studio версии в «Диспетчере устройств».
Можно ли использовать видеокарту для рендеринга видео в MP4?
Да, при выборе кодека H.264 или HEVC в настройках «Render Queue» и «Output Module», After Effects может использовать аппаратное кодирование через видеокарту, что ускоряет процесс в разы.
Сколько видеокарт можно подключить для ускорения?
After Effects, как правило, использует только одну видеокарту для рендеринга проекта, даже если у вас установлено несколько. GPU конфигурации поддерживаются ограниченно и требуют сложной настройки.
Что делать, если рендеринг стал медленнее после включения GPU?
Возможно, выбранный эффект или кодек не оптимизирован под вашу видеокарту. Попробуйте отключить аппаратное ускорение для конкретных эффектов или обновить драйверы до последней версии.